Pontiac rear end swap

will the posi unit out of a early 80's 10 bolt out of a trans am fit into a 82 10 bolt in a Pontic wagon?

http://www.oldsmobility.com/10bolt-tech.htm has ID info for various GM rear ends. You're probably dealing with one of the 8.5" or 7.5" units. See which one(s) you have. If both are the same size, the posi unit will probably fit, but you have to make sure it's compatible with your gear ratio. Each design had two different carrier "series", depending on what gear ratio they were used with. Higher ratio gears tend to have the ring gear closer to the centerline of the pinion gear, and the ring gear flange position is how they differ.
